2002 Mercedes C230K stuck in limp mode even after replacing conductor plate

My car switched to limp mode and started throwing P0715 code -->input/turbine speed sensor A circuit and the check engine light was on. I went ahead and replaced the conductor plate and 13 pin connector. But it is still stuck in limp mode. Checked the wiring that goes into TCM. the wiring was covered with oil, but none went into the TCM and looked clean. Sprayed electrical connector cleaner to make sure the plugs and wiring are cleaned. Even after all this, i still get the code. I tried to erase the code with an OBD2 Scanner, but check engine light turns back on.

Need help. Have no clue what to do next

You need a mercedes specific scanner that can speak to the transmission directly in order to clear that code. I used an icarsoft i980. P0715 is a generic engine code that basically tells the engine theres something wrong with the transmission but the code is stored in the TCM. You need to clear the code in the TCM which most generic OBD2 code readers won't do.

Thank you for the information. So having code erased through the specified scanner should fix the problem?
Assuming the mechanical problem that caused the code in the first place has been fixed, yes.

It should, yes.

You could try to disconnect the battery for a bit and see if it clears the TCM faults but that doesn't always work.

You were so right... got the scanner, erased the codes and it started running perfectly... thanks a ton,
